UNPKG

@dndbuilder.com/react

Version:

Drag and drop builder for React

75 lines (74 loc) 2.44 kB
"use client"; import { jsxs as t, jsx as e } from "react/jsx-runtime"; import { PresetsControl as l } from "../../../components/controls/presets-control.js"; import { SelectControl as m } from "../../../components/controls/select.control.js"; import { SliderInputControl as s } from "../../../components/controls/slider-input.control.js"; import { Accordion as r } from "../../../components/shared/accordion.js"; import { Label as n } from "../../../components/shared/label.js"; import { Separator as a } from "../../../components/shared/separator.js"; import { SettingsType as o } from "../../../types/index.js"; import p from "../img/design-1.png.js"; import d from "../img/design-2.png.js"; import { TestimonialPresets as i } from "../types/index.js"; import c from "./slider-options.control.js"; import f from "./testimonials.js"; const L = () => /* @__PURE__ */ t(r, { defaultValue: "General", type: "single", collapsible: !0, children: [ /* @__PURE__ */ t(r.Item, { value: "General", children: [ /* @__PURE__ */ e(r.Trigger, { className: "p-4", children: "General" }), /* @__PURE__ */ t(r.Content, { className: "px-4", children: [ /* @__PURE__ */ e( m, { type: o.BLOCK, fieldName: "layout.desktop", label: "Layout", options: [ { content: "Grid", value: "grid" }, { content: "Slider", value: "slider" } ], className: "mt-0" } ), /* @__PURE__ */ e( s, { responsive: !0, type: o.BLOCK, fieldName: "columns", label: "Columns", min: 1, max: 10 } ), /* @__PURE__ */ e(a, { className: "my-4" }), /* @__PURE__ */ e(n, { className: "mb-2", children: "Testimonials" }), /* @__PURE__ */ e(f, {}) ] }) ] }), /* @__PURE__ */ t(r.Item, { value: "Presets", children: [ /* @__PURE__ */ e(r.Trigger, { className: "p-4", children: "Presets" }), /* @__PURE__ */ e(r.Content, { className: "px-4", children: /* @__PURE__ */ e( l, { designs: [ { id: i.Preset1, image: p }, { id: i.Preset2, image: d } ] } ) }) ] }), /* @__PURE__ */ e(c, {}) ] }); export { L as default }; //# sourceMappingURL=testimonial-content.control.js.map